Agarnaral Population - Ratnagiri, Maharashtra
Agarnaral is a medium size village located in Ratnagiri Taluka of Ratnagiri district, Maharashtra with total 318 families residing. The Agarnaral village has population of 1324 of which 611 are males while 713 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Agarnaral village population of children with age 0-6 is 131 which makes up 9.89 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Agarnaral village is 1167 which is higher than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Agarnaral as per census is 1047, higher than Maharashtra average of 894.
Agarnaral village has lower liter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Agarnaral village was 79.63 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Agarnaral Male literacy stands at 90.68 % while female literacy rate was 70.28 %.

Agarnaral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 318 | - | - |
Population | 1,324 | 611 | 713 |
Child (0-6) | 131 | 64 | 67 |
Schedule Caste | 97 | 39 | 58 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 79.63 % | 90.68 % | 70.28 % |
Total Workers | 449 | 319 | 130 |
Main Worker | 171 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 278 | 157 | 121 |
